Marriage is the end of love according to many people. Though it appears to be true, it need not be so in practice. Career tensions, household responsibilities, ego problems, child care, financial issues etc., may occupy more space between a couple, especially if they are married for long. But if you believe your life is in your hands, then there are many occasions to bring back your honeymooning days. And nothing beats the Valentine day for accomplishing this!

Follow these few tips to celebrate your love this memorable day...........



  • Wake up an hour before you generally do and spend some time together sitting in the balcony sipping a cup of coffee before the sun rises. Enjoy the romantic spirit the morning breeze fills in you. 
  • Dress up as romantic as you can for your darling and groom yourself well. This day is meant for celebrating love and as a couple you are more blessed to do it.
  • Plan a surprise to your loved one, may be a romantic trip like rain dance, a park, a romantic film, a long drive or a romantic full moon dinner. (You are lucky this time to have a full moon on V-day so don't miss this opportunity.)
  • Present a romantic gift to your hubby and see the smile on his beautiful face.
  • Prepare a lunch favorite for your darling. If he is off to office, put a love note in his lunch box without his knowledge and am sure you will get a lovable call from him in the lunch time. 
  • Remember your newly wed days or time both of you spent together before marriage and send a love message or a romantic poetry.
  • If you had an argument or have a dispute, relieve yourself by saying a little "sorry" and bring back your love this V-day.
  • Don't discuss anything related to finances or relatives or children's issues or career or anything routine on this day. This day is meant just for your love.
  • Chinese lantern festival coincides with V-day this time. Light a lantern in your bedroom or dining space and express your love with a beautiful rose.
  • Open your photo album together and memorize all your lovely days.
  • And most importantly, put your kids to bed soon and enjoy a romantic night!!!
